Understanding Roblox’s Age-Based Features

Before diving into the specifics of changing age restrictions, it’s crucial to grasp how Roblox categorizes users and the features associated with each age group. This framework underpins the platform’s safety protocols.

The Two Primary Age Categories

Roblox broadly divides its users into two primary age categories:

  • Users Under 13: These users typically have more restricted access to features, including communication options and the types of content they can view. The goal is to protect younger users from potential dangers.
  • Users 13 and Over: This age group generally has more freedom within the platform, including expanded communication features and access to a wider range of experiences. However, parental controls are still available to customize their experience.

How Age Affects In-Game Experiences

Age verification on Roblox significantly influences the types of games and experiences a user can access. Younger users will be restricted to content deemed suitable for their age range, while older users can explore a broader selection. This ensures that content aligns with the platform’s safety guidelines and the Children’s Online Privacy Protection Act (COPPA).

Setting Up Parental Controls: The Foundation of Management

Parental controls are the cornerstone of managing a child’s experience on Roblox. They allow parents to customize their child’s interactions and access, creating a safer and more tailored experience.

Accessing Parental Control Settings

Accessing parental control settings is straightforward. You’ll need to:

  1. Log in to the parent account: If you don’t have one, you’ll need to create a new account.
  2. Navigate to the “Settings” section: This is typically found by clicking the gear icon in the top right corner of the website or app.
  3. Select “Parental Controls”: This will display the available options for managing your child’s account.

Customizing Communication Settings

One of the most crucial aspects of parental controls is managing communication settings. You can control who your child can interact with on the platform. Options typically include:

  • No communication: Disabling all in-game chat and messaging features.
  • Friends only: Allowing communication only with users who are on your child’s friends list.
  • Friends and followers: Expanding communication to include users who follow your child.
  • Everyone: Allowing communication with anyone on the platform (this is generally not recommended for younger users).

Managing Privacy and Content Restrictions

Beyond communication, parental controls enable you to restrict access to certain types of content. This includes:

  • Restricting games: Blocking access to specific games or experiences that you deem inappropriate.
  • Filtering chat: Enabling a content filter to automatically block inappropriate language.
  • Managing friend requests: Approving or denying friend requests on behalf of your child.
  • Setting spending limits: Controlling how much Robux (Roblox’s virtual currency) your child can spend.

Steps to Potentially Adjust Age Settings (and the Limitations)

It’s essential to understand that directly “changing” a user’s age on Roblox is generally not possible. Roblox uses the provided birthdate as the basis for age-based restrictions. However, there are some considerations and potential indirect adjustments.

The Impossibility of Directly Changing the Birthdate

You cannot directly change the birthdate associated with an existing Roblox account. This information is locked in place to ensure the integrity of age-based restrictions.

The Impact of Accidental Incorrect Birthdate Entry

If an incorrect birthdate was entered during account creation, the account will function under the age restrictions associated with the incorrect age. There is no direct mechanism to correct this. However, in some cases, contacting Roblox support might be beneficial, though there is no guarantee of a change.

The Role of Parental Controls in Circumventing Restrictions

While you cannot change the age of the account, parental controls provide powerful tools to customize the user experience, allowing parents to override some of the built-in restrictions. For example, you might choose to allow communication with “Friends and Followers” even if the child is under 13.

Troubleshooting Common Age Restriction Issues

Even with robust parental controls, you might encounter problems. Here are some common issues and how to address them:

Account Locked Due to Age Verification

If an account is locked due to age verification issues, you will need to contact Roblox support to attempt to resolve the issue. Providing documentation, such as a birth certificate, might be requested to verify the user’s age.

Difficulty Accessing Certain Games or Features

If a user is unable to access a specific game or feature, double-check their age and the game’s age rating. Also, review the parental control settings to ensure they are not blocking the content.

Issues with Communication Restrictions

If communication restrictions are not working as expected, verify the settings in the parental control panel. Ensure that the desired level of communication (e.g., “Friends Only”) is selected and saved.
